About This Video

In this video, I’m sharing a very specific kind of tarot joy: the decks in my collection that used to be ignored (or at least seriously under-loved) and that I’ve come to genuinely adore as of 2025. This is less of a “new shiny thing” roundup and more of a check-in with my real, lived tarot practice—what I’m actually reaching for, what’s finally clicking, and why some decks needed time, context, or a different season of my life to open up for me. I walk through each deck and talk about what changed for me—whether it was my reading methods evolving, my relationship to imagery shifting, or me realizing a deck is better for reflection than for quick pulls. The decks I feature are: Le Tarot Arthurian, Faceted Garden Oracle, Somnia Tarot, Da Vinci Tarot, Voyager Tarot, Serpent & Peacock (1st ed.), and Naturescapes Tarot. If you’ve got decks gathering dust, my biggest takeaway is this: “neglected” doesn’t always mean “not for you”—sometimes it just means “not yet,” and the right approach (or the right moment) makes all the difference.
